Freight trailer costs from Plano, TX to San Bernardino, CA
Freight trailers are a solid option for larger DIY moves from Plano, Texas, to San Bernardino, California. Standard trailers run 28 feet long, and you're only charged for the portion you actually fill. The carrier drops the trailer off, you load it at your own pace, and they handle the drive to your new city.
Pricing is based entirely on the linear footage your shipment occupies, not the full trailer length. Most long-distance freight moves land somewhere between $1,033 and $2,893.
Take a look at freight trailer costs based on home size for moves from Plano to San Bernardino:
- Studio apartment / 1 bedroom: $1,323 - $2,330
- 2 - 3 bedrooms: $1,387 - $2,893
- 4+ bedrooms: $1,865 - $3,931
Pro tip: Freight trailers come with a 4-foot loading ramp, which can be a challenge with bulky furniture. With 8 feet of vertical space available, stacking efficiently often requires a ladder and a plan. Since you're billed per linear foot, packing tight can make a real difference in your final cost.

What are some tips for saving money on a move from Plano, TX to San Bernardino, CA?
Cutting 500 pounds from your shipment, roughly one bedroom's worth of items, saves approximately $200 - $400 on a full-service move on this route. Beyond that, staying organized matters just as much. A solid moving checklist keeps you on schedule and helps you avoid costly last-minute mistakes.
What is the best time of year to move from Plano, TX to San Bernardino, CA?
Aim for a move between October and March, when demand drops and rates tend to be lower across all service types. Peak season runs mid-May through mid-September, and weekends and month-end dates are pricier regardless of season. A midweek, mid-month date outside peak season is your best bet for saving money.
How long does a move from Plano, TX to San Bernardino, CA take?
Full-service movers and container companies typically complete this route in 5 - 7 days, since carriers consolidate shipments heading the same direction. Freight trailers are usually the fastest option outside of driving yourself, with deliveries in 3 - 5 days, though you'll need to be ready to receive your shipment on arrival.
